  2. Bookkeeping..... • From 1982 - 30 years ago we wrote up cash books manually... • from 1990s. PCs took over • Pastel and similar packages • Punching into Accounting packages from bank statements was great! • And now 22 years later, most people are STILL punching in Accounting packages from bank statement line by line...which are: • Open to human processing error... • Very costly in time and money... • Very tedious and boring...

Step by Step – Summary • Step 1) Download Bank Statement files • Step 2) Open SmartBank • Step 3) Import Bank Statement file into SmartBank • Step 4) Allocate (Auto) & Edit ledger transactions • Step 5) Export the allocated transactions • Step 6) Import into Accounting package(e.g.Pastel) • -> Direct Import to Pastel coming soon...

  10. Step 1) Download Bank Statement files Critical to download correct FILE from the bank (NOT PDF!!) Search for .OFX/.OFC preferably (CSV as last resort) SmartBank can: - VIEW and PRINT OFX and OFX/OFC files- Recognises and avoids duplicate transactions

Downloading bank transaction history files is the KEY! • Nedbank is the only bank that can go back 30 months or more • Other Banks can only 3 to 6 months • Solution • Teach / Educate clients into this new way of thinking! • Ensure clients to regularly download Bank statement files daily, weekly monthly or bi monthly • Rename files meaningfully • Save and backup downloaded Bank files in a regular folder on C: drive
